“Play now and pay later OR pay now and play later.” From your first paycheck to your most recent one, Dale Alexander shares wisdom on focusing in on your financial dreams, having “The Talk (About Money)" with your family, and how to treat new money as it enters your life. As an author and motivational speaker, Dale discusses finances through a practical, philosophical, and philanthropic lens. Dale shares:• Why money is difficult to talk about• The benefit of treating 70% of your paycheck as 100%• How to supercharge the other 30% of your paycheck• The true impact of giving Uplifting and enlightening, this episode is meant to supercharge your approach to your finances!
